I Know Where I'm Going! Revisited
Originally released in 1994. I Know Where I'm Going! Revisited is a documentary film. directed by Mark Cousins. At just 40 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Mark Cousins, Petula Clark, and Wendy Hiller
Synopsis
Nancy Franklin was so overwhelmed by the film 'I Know Where I'm Going!' (1945) that she traveled from New York to the Western Isles of Scotland to see the places where it was made and to find out more about the people who made it. This documentary retraces her steps on a subsequent visit.
